These children show progressive deformity throughout the period of growth and can develop severe kyphosis of > 100A degrees. Such kyphosis is severely disabling with significant risk of neurological deficit and respiratory compromise. Surgical correction of these deformities by both anterior and posterior approaches has been described but each have serious limitations of approach, correctability and safety. We describe here a technique of posterior closing-anterior opening

osteotomy, which allowed us to correct a rigid post-tubercular deformity of 118A degrees in a 13-year-old boy with neglected spinal tuberculosis. The patient was a 13-year-old boy, who had contracted spinal tuberculosis at the age of 6 years. Although the disease was cured by anti-tubercular chemotherapy, he continued to deteriorate in deformity and presented to us with severe thoracolumbar kyphosis (118A degrees). Radiographs revealed complete destruction of T12, L1 and L2 vertebral bodies with the T11 vertebra fusing with L3 anteriorly. CT scans and MRI revealed severe collapse of the vertebral column and the spinal cord being stretched over the ‘internal gibbus’, which was formed by the remnants of the destroyed vertebrae. A single stage closing-opening osteotomy was done by a midline posterior approach with continuous intraoperative spinal cord monitoring. The procedure involved extensive laminectomy of T11-L2, pedicle screw fixation of three levels above and three levels below the apex, a wedge osteotomy at the apex of the deformity from both sides, anterior column reconstruction by appropriate-sized titanium cage and gradual correction of deformity by closing the posterior column using the cage as a fulcrum. learn more This allowed us to achieve a correction to 38A degrees (68% correction). “Current DNA extraction protocols, which require liquid nitrogen, lyophilization and considerable infrastructure in terms of instrumentation, often impede the application of biotechnological tools in less researched crops in laboratories

in developing learn more countries. We modified and optimized the existing CTAB method for plant genomic DNA extraction by avoiding liquid nitrogen usage and lyophilization. DNA was extracted directly from freshly harvested leaves ground in pre-heated CTAB buffer. Chloroform:isoamyl alcohol (24:1) and RNase treatments GW4869 mouse followed by single-purification step decontaminated the samples thereby paving way for selective extraction of DNA. High molecular weight DNA yield in the range of 328 to 4776 ng/mu L with an average of 1459 ng/mu L was obtained from 45 samples of cultivated and wild Cajanus species. With an absorbance ratio at 260 to 280 nm, a range of 1.66 to 2.20, and a mean of 1.85, very low levels of protein and polysaccharide contamination were recorded.

Forty samples can be extracted daily at a cost between 1.8 and US$2.0 per plant sample. This modified method is suitable for most plants especially members of the Leguminosae. Apart from Cajanus, it has been extensively applied in DNA extraction from Cicer and Vigna species.”

“Recently, a novel approach has been developed to study gene expression in single cells with high time resolution using RNA Fluorescent In Situ Hybridization (FISH). The technique allows individual mRNAs to be counted with high accuracy in wildtype cells, but requires cells to be fixed; thus, each cell provides only a “”snapshot”" of gene expression. Here we show how and when RNA FISH data on pairs of genes can be used to reconstruct real-time dynamics from a collection of such snapshots. Using maximum-likelihood parameter estimation on synthetically generated, noisy FISH data, we show that dynamical programs of gene expression, such as cycles (e.g., the cell cycle) or switches between discrete states, can be accurately reconstructed. In the limit that mRNAs are produced in short-lived bursts, binary thresholding of the FISH data provides a robust way of reconstructing dynamics. In this regime, prior knowledge of the type of dynamics – cycle versus switch – is generally required and additional constraints, e.g., from triplet FISH measurements, may also be needed to fully constrain all parameters.

“In the present work, nonlocal elasticity theory has been implemented to study the vibration response of single-layered graphene (SLGS) sheets. The nonlocal elasticity theory accounts for the small size effects when dealing with nanostructures. Influence of the surrounding elastic medium on the fundamental frequencies of the SLGS is investigated. Both Winkler-type and Pasternak-type models are employed to simulate the interaction of the graphene sheets with a surrounding elastic medium. On the basis of Hamilton’s principle Selleck Vorinostat governing differential equations for the aforementioned problems are derived. The nonlocal small scale coefficients get introduced into the nonlocal theory through the constitutive relations. Differential quadrature method is being employed and numerical solutions for the frequencies are obtained.

Numerical results show that the fundamental frequencies of SLGS are strongly dependent on the small scale coefficients. Further, a nonlinear frequency response is observed for the SLGS with larger nonlocal effects and “”Winkler-type modeled”" surrounding medium.”

“Room-temperature fabrication of Schottky diodes was demonstrated for p-type boron-doped diamond. This Selleck AP24534 fabrication method’s key technique is selective modification of surface termination from monohydride into oxygen groups using vacuum ultraviolet light irradiation in oxygen. The Au contacts, formed on the hydrogen-terminated surface, maintained Ohmic properties after this selective surface oxidation. The Au contacts then deposited on the oxidized surface, imparting Schottky

properties. The lateral-type diodes comprising Au Schottky contacts and Au Ohmic contacts showed blocking voltage higher than 1 kV without electrode guarding. The leakage current at 1 kV was as low as 30 pA. (C) 2009 American Institute of Physics. [DOI: 10.1063/1.3153986]“

“BACKGROUND: Our management of patients with idiopathic pulmonary arterial hypertension (iPAH) awaiting lung LY3023414 transplantation changed in 2006 with the introduction of extracorporeal life support (ECLS) as an option to bridge these patients to transplantation (BTT).

METHODS: To study the effect of this change on waiting

list mortality and post-transplant outcome, 21 consecutive iPAH patients listed for lung transplantation between January 2006 and September 2010 (second cohort) were compared with 23 consecutive iPAH patients listed between January 1997 and December 2005 (first cohort).

RESULTS: Between the first and second cohort, the number of patients admitted to

the hospital as BTT increased from 4% (1 of 23) to 48% (10 of 21; p = 0.0009). Six patients were BTT with ECLS in the second cohort, including 4 with the Nova lung device (Nova lung GmbH, Hechingen, Germany) connected as a pumpless oxygenating right-to-left shunt between the pulmonary artery and left atrium. While on the waiting list, 5 patients (22%) died in the first cohort and none in the second cohort (p = 0.03). Time on the waiting list decreased from 118 +/- 85 to 53 +/- 40 days between the first and second cohort (p = 0.004). After lung transplantation, the 30-day mortality was 16.7% in the P005091 Ubiquitin inhibitor first cohort and 9.5% in the second cohort (p = 0.5). The postoperative intensive Selleck Birinapant care unit stay increased from 17 +/- 13 to 36 +/- 30 days between the first and second cohort (p = 0.02). The long-term outcome after lung transplantation

remained similar between both cohorts.

CONCLUSIONS: Aggressive management with ECLS of iPAH patients awaiting lung transplantation could have a major impact to reduce the waiting list mortality. This may, however, be associated with longer intensive care unit stay after transplant. J Heart Lung Transplant 2011;30:997-1002 (C) 2011 International Society for Heart and Lung Transplantation. “Protection of the small intestine from mucosal injury this website induced by nonsteroidal anti-inflammatory drugs including acetylsalicylic acid is a critical issue in the field of gastroenterology. Polaprezinc an anti-ulcer drug, consisting of zinc and L-carnosine, provides gastric mucosal protection against various irritants. In this study, we investigated the protective effect of polaprezinc on acetylsalicylic acid-induced apoptosis of the RIE1 rat intestinal epithelial cell line. Confluent rat intestinal epithelial cells were incubated with 70 mu M polaprezinc for 24 h, and then stimulated with or without 15 mM acetylsalicylic acid for a further 15 h. Subsequent cellular viability was quantified by fluorometric assay based on cell lysis and staining. Acetylsalicylic acid-induced cell death was also qualified by fluorescent microscopy of Hoechst33342 and propidium iodide. Heat shock proteins 70 protein expression after adding

polaprezinc or acetylsalicylic acid was assessed by western blotting. To investigate the role of Heat shock protein 70, Heat shock protein 70-specific small interfering RNA was applied. Cell viability was quantified by fluorometric assay based on cell lysis and staining and apoptosis was analyzed by fluorescence-activated Bcl-2 apoptosis pathway cell sorting. We found that acetylsalicylic acid significantly induced apoptosis of rat intestinal epithelial cells in a dose- and time-dependent manner. Polaprezinc significantly suppressed acetylsalicylic acid-induced apoptosis of rat intestinal epithelial cells at its late phase. At the same time, polaprezinc increased Heat shock protein 70 expressions of rat intestinal epithelial cells in a time-dependent manner. However, in Heat shock protein 70-silenced rat intestinal epithelial cells, polaprezinc could not suppress acetylsalicylic acid -induced apoptosis at its late phase.
